Assembly step 6:
Attaching the anti-skating weight
As an anti-skating device, the T700 has a weight
that generates a counterforce via a small pin
on the tonearm bearing.
This small weight is located in the accessories box and is attached to the pen with a small thread via a deflection unit. For the
5.0 g anti-skating weight (diameter 9 mm) is recommended to use the middle groove in the pin. If you have the smaller 1.8 g
anti-skating weight (diameter 6 mm), the outer groove is recommended.
Note:
The determination of the tracking force (assembly step 5) must always be carried out without the anti-skating weight,
as otherwise measurement errors may occur. With the help of the tonearm scales you can easily determine the weight
of your anti-skating weight.
Assembly Step 7:
Connecting T700 turntable
In the last step, connect the T700 turntable to the power supply and the hi-fi amplifier.
Power supply:
On the back of the T700 turntable is the input socket for the external power supply, which is included in the scope of delivery.
Insert the barrel connector into the socket labeled
DC Power
. Only the power supply unit supplied by Revox may be used.
Third-party power supplies can cause damage and malfunctions that are not covered by the warranty.
Technical data power supply unit:
input
100-240 VAC / 50-60 Hz
output 12 - 15 VDC / minimum 1A
Audio connection:
The T700 has a very high quality MC phono amplifier, which is preconfigured for the
Ortofon Quintet Bronze
pick-up system in
the factory. At the output of the cinch sockets
Analog Line Output
, the T700 outputs a stereo audio signal at line level. This
means that the T700 can be connected directly to any analog input of an amplifier, receiver or an Audiobar from Revox without
the need for a separate phono preamplifier. These inputs are usually identified with the names
Line-IN, Analog Input, Aux, CD,
Tuner, Tape
.
Note: The T700
must not
be connected to an MC or MM input of an amplifier!
A separate ground line, as is usual with turntables without an integrated phono preamplifier, is not necessary with the
STUDIO
MASTER T700. Thanks to the amplified signal at line level, the risk of interference is no longer as critical as with
turntables without a preamplifier. However, for audiophile reasons, Revox recommends using a high quality, well-shielded cinch
cable. Specialist stores or retailers can provide good advice on this matter.
